ฉันมีเซิร์ฟเวอร์ DNS เพื่อกำหนดเส้นทางการรับส่งข้อมูลไปยังบริการในพื้นที่ ตัวอย่างเช่นมันชี้ router.home.lan
ไปยังเราเตอร์ของฉัน
อย่างไรก็ตาม เมื่อฉันพยายามไปที่ที่อยู่นี้ในเบราว์เซอร์บนเครื่อง Ubuntu ของฉัน การโหลดใช้เวลานานมาก ถ้าฉันไปที่เพจบน Macbook หรือใช้ที่อยู่ IP บนเครื่อง Ubuntu ของฉัน เพจจะโหลดทันที
ฉันเชื่อว่ามีบางอย่างเกี่ยวข้องกับการแก้ไข DNS บนเครื่อง Ubuntu ของฉัน นี่คือผลลัพธ์จาก เจ้าภาพ
:
เวลาโฮสต์ -v router.home.lan
ลอง "router.home.lan"
;; ->>HEADER<<- opcode: QUERY, สถานะ: NOERROR, id: 59318
;; ธง: qr rd ra; คำถาม: 1, คำตอบ: 1, ผู้มีอำนาจ: 0, เพิ่มเติม: 0
;; ส่วนคำถาม:
;router.home.lan. ใน
;; ส่วนคำตอบ:
router.home.lan. 2 ใน 192.168.1.1
ได้รับ 49 ไบต์จาก 127.0.0.53#53 ใน 12 มิลลิวินาที
ลอง "router.home.lan"
;; หมดเวลาการเชื่อมต่อ; ไม่สามารถเข้าถึงเซิร์ฟเวอร์ได้
ลอง "router.home.lan"
;; หมดเวลาการเชื่อมต่อ; ไม่สามารถเข้าถึงเซิร์ฟเวอร์ได้
โฮสต์ -v router.home.lan 0.01s ผู้ใช้ 0.01s ระบบ 0% cpu 20.021 ทั้งหมด
ผลลัพธ์แรกจะกลับมาทันที จากนั้นสองครั้งถัดไปจะออกหลังจากครั้งละ 10 วินาที ฉันได้รับพฤติกรรมเดียวกันกับ ปิง
.
สิ่งนี้เกิดขึ้นกับบริการในพื้นที่ของฉันเท่านั้น โฮม.แลน
โดเมน.
การเปลี่ยนแปลง เนมเซิร์ฟเวอร์
ใน /etc/resolv.conf
ไปที่ IP ของเซิร์ฟเวอร์ DNS ในเครื่องของฉันช่วยแก้ไขปัญหาได้ แต่นั่นไม่ยั่งยืนเนื่องจากมักถูกเขียนทับและทำให้เกิดปัญหานอกเครือข่ายของฉัน